About This Location

In the heart of the picturesque Acadia National Park in Bar Harbor, Maine, lies a natural wonder that has captivated visitors for generations—Thunder Hole. Revered as one of the park's premier attractions, Thunder Hole offers an awe-inspiring experience that connects you with the raw power of the ocean. This location always lives up to the hype!

What sets Thunder Hole apart is its ability to showcase the relentless force of the sea as it collides with the rugged Maine shoreline. Over millions of years, the relentless waves have carved out this remarkable inlet in the coastal rocks, creating a spectacle that you must witness when visiting Acadia National Park. As the waves rush into the narrow inlet, they unleash a symphony of sights and sounds that are nothing short of breathtaking. The name "Thunder Hole" is not an exaggeration; the crash and roar of the waves are reminiscent of distant thunderclaps, hence the name. Sometimes, these oceanic juggernauts can send plumes of seawater soaring as high as 50 feet into the air, drenching the surrounding rocks and creating a mesmerizing spectacle.

To ensure the safety of visitors, Thunder Hole is equipped with sturdy safety rails that allow you to explore its wonders up close while being protected from the ocean's ferocity. These precautions enable you to witness nature's raw power in all its glory without any danger. A poncho can also be a wise idea depending on the conditions.

Conveniently located along the Park Loop Road, Thunder Hole has its dedicated parking area, making it easily accessible to all park visitors. However, due to its immense popularity, the dedicated parking area can fill up quickly, particularly on beautiful days. As a savvy traveler, arriving early in the day is a prudent choice. This ensures that you secure a parking spot, allowing you to immerse yourself in the majesty of Thunder Hole without any hassle.

Parking Notes:
There is a large parking lot right across from the access point to Thunder Hole along Park Loop Road. The parking lot holds around 50 cars, although it does fill up on nice days. If the lot is full, there is additional parking located further down Park Loop Road at the Gorham Mountain Trailhead lot.
